cradle a small bed for a baby that can move from side to side.
cupboard a piece of furniture with shelves to store food, dishes, or other things.
daylight the light of the day.
disturb to interrupt by making noise or doing something that draws away attention.
fable a short tale that teaches a lesson. The characters in fables are often animals who speak and act like people.
fool A person who has poor sense or judgment.
gown a dress worn on special occasions.
musician a person who has skill at playing, singing, or writing music.
pin a thin piece of metal with a sharp point and flat or round head. Pins are used to fasten or attach pieces of cloth or similar material.
shout to call out in a loud voice.
slap to hit with an open hand.
step each single movement of your foot as you walk.
struggle the act or an instance of making a strong effort to resist or escape, especially by wriggling the body.
thirst the feeling that you need or want to drink something.
travel to go from place to place.
